Formatted Contents Note: | The Power of the President -- Naming the Leader -- Electing the President -- Who Can Run? -- Taking Over -- Presidential Payment -- The Oath of Office -- Commander in Chief -- Dealing with Other Countries -- Job Openings -- The State of the Union -- Can Presidents Be Punished? -- A Strong and Balanced Government. |
Summary, etc.: | "Americans often have questions about what the president can and can't do, and many of these questions are answered in Article II of the US Constitution. From declaring war to appointing ambassadors and Supreme Court justices, the powers of the presidency are outlined in this helpful guide to the executive branch. The informative text connects the past and present using language from the Constitution explained in an accessible way and current examples of the executive branch in action. Featuring primary sources, graphic organizers, fact boxes, and sidebars, this engaging reading experience helps foster a sense of informed and active citizenship"-- Provided by publisher. |
